Epson STYLUS SX218 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Print TechnologyInkjet
FunctionsPrint, Scan, Copy
Maximum Print Resolution5760 x 1440 dpi
Max. Color Print Speed15 ppm
Scanner TypeFlatbed
Scanner Optical Resolution1200 x 2400 dpi
ConnectivityUSB
Weight5.2 kg
Compatible Operating SystemsWindows, Mac OS
Paper SizeA4
Paper Capacity100 sheets
Ink Cartridges4
